0
新しいクライアント接続が確立されたときにPaho Javaクライアントにコールバック関数がありますか?その機能の中で、ユーザーを検証し、失敗した場合は接続を拒否したい。新しいクライアントがPaho Javaクライアントに接続するときのコールバック関数
新しいクライアントがjavascriptまたは任意のクライアントから接続するとき、私は新しいクライアントを許可または拒否できなければなりません。
新しいクライアント接続が確立されたときにPaho Javaクライアントにコールバック関数がありますか?その機能の中で、ユーザーを検証し、失敗した場合は接続を拒否したい。新しいクライアントがPaho Javaクライアントに接続するときのコールバック関数
新しいクライアントがjavascriptまたは任意のクライアントから接続するとき、私は新しいクライアントを許可または拒否できなければなりません。
これは、クライアントから行うことはできません、MQTTプロトコルはブローカーではなく、他の方法でのラウンドに単一のクライアントから認証情報を渡す以外をサポートしていません。
ブローカー内から行う必要があります。異なるブローカはすべて認証を別々に実装するため、使用しているブローカに完全に依存します。
Mosquittoは、認証プラグインを書くためのAPIを持っています。例えばhttps://github.com/mcollina/mosca/wiki/Authentication-&-Authorization
あなたはPAHO Javaクライアントを使用してMQTTブローカーを実装しようとしているか、接続されたクライアントからのブローカーのユーザーを検証したいです - https://github.com/jpmens/mosquitto-auth-plug
HiveMQはまた、API http://www.hivemq.com/blog/mqtt-security-fundamentals-advanced-authentication-mechanisms
モスカを持っていますか? – hardillb
は、接続されたクライアントからブローカのユーザーを検証します。私はすべての接続要求を傍受し、ユーザー名とパスワードでそれらを検証します。ユーザー名とパスワードが一致すれば、私はブローカーへの接続を拒否していれば、それらを接続できるようにしたい – manish